I would suggest Discovery Cove. For a birthday celebration, it's the best. I took my boyfriend for his birthday in March and suprised him with the 89 dollar birthday package, which consisted of a free picture, tshirt, bag, picture frame, and a buoy that said "happy birthday" that the dolphin carried in its mouth to him during out dolphin encounter. It's great with the aviary, stingray pool, and reef for snorkeling. The Atlantis is a gorgeous resort, but very expensive. Unless you're prepared to spend thousands of dollars to stay there, go to Discovery Cove. If you want a multiple day celebration, choose Atlantis, but do the dolphin swim or encounter or sea lion encounter at Blue Lagoon Island. There is a ferry across the street that takes you there and back. It's a beautiful lagoon and it's been there for a long time, so they're great at what they do. The Atlantis dolphin program is fairly new. dolphinencounters.com

Haborside Atlantis is the way to go. Rent a full condo from a current timeshare owner at www.redweek.com. Most weeks could be had for $1200-1400, including all taxes and cleaaning fees. It is part of the resort, free shuttles every 5 min to other towers, beaches, casino, and pools. Have your cabbie stop at the grocery on the ride to your condo. Food at groicery more expensive that your USA grocery, but stiill much better than Atlantis food charges (literally $8 PER SLICE of pizza and $14 for a deli sandwich at Murry's on site).
